  3. I agree. They paid out a lot of $ in guarantees to some pretty good teams last year. Apparently they weren't willing to do so again this year. Part of the problem is that it just isn't very easy or inexpensive for a team from out of the area to get to Grand Forks. Therefore, teams "need" a good guarantee to travel to ND when there are plenty of other high calibre teams for them to play closer to home. It gets back to geography - UND's location makes it very difficult and expensive to recruit - and find teams to play in GF.
